Project Perspective
Materia 101: Find The Perfect Temperature For Your Filament คือสะพานเชื่อม "Calibration Interaction" ที่เป็นพื้นฐานและสร้างสรรค์สำหรับนักพัฒนาอิเล็กทรอนิกส์ยุคใหม่ ด้วยการมุ่งเน้นที่องค์ประกอบสำคัญ—การ G-code-temp-variable mapping และ high-performance thermal-extrusion and layer-dispatch logic—คุณจะได้เรียนรู้วิธีปรับทิศทางและทำการปรับแต่งครั้งแรกโดยอัตโนมัติโดยใช้ software logic เฉพาะทางและการตั้งค่าพื้นฐานที่แข็งแกร่ง
Technical Implementation: Thermal Curves and Layer-Variable Injections
โปรเจกต์นี้จะเผยให้เห็นถึงเลเยอร์ที่ซ่อนอยู่ของการโต้ตอบแบบง่ายๆ ตั้งแต่การตรวจจับไปจนถึงวัตถุ:
- Identification layer: Slic3r Post-Processor ทำหน้าที่เหมือนดวงตาเชิงพื้นที่ความละเอียดสูง โดยวัดทุกจุดของเลเยอร์เครื่องพิมพ์ผ่าน temperature increment code ภายใน
- Conversion layer: ระบบใช้ digital protocol ความเร็วสูง (Serial-over-USB/SD) เพื่อรับแพ็กเก็ตข้อมูลพิกัดความเร็วสูงและประสานงานกับงานตรวจจับที่สำคัญ
- Visual Interface layer: Materia 101 LCD ให้การตอบสนองทางภาพและกลไกความละเอียดสูงทุกครั้งที่คุณตรวจสอบสถานะการพิมพ์ (เช่น Current Temp, Target Temp)
- Control Gateway layer: Cartesian Steppers (XYZ) มีตัวเลือกสำหรับการโอเวอร์ไรด์พารามิเตอร์ด้วยตนเอง หรือการตรวจสอบสถานะอัตโนมัติระหว่างการ calibration ครั้งแรกเพื่อประสานงานสถานะ
- Processing Logic logic: server code ใช้กลยุทธ์ "temp-bridge-dispatch" (หรือ tower-dispatch): มันตีความ G-code modifiers และจับคู่กับ nozzle heaters เพื่อให้การปรับระดับความร้อนเป็นไปอย่างปลอดภัยและเป็นจังหวะ
- Communication Dialogue Loop: note codes ถูกส่งเป็นจังหวะไปยัง Serial Monitor ระหว่างการ calibration ครั้งแรกเพื่อประสานงานสถานะ
Hardware-Printing Infrastructure
- Materia 101: "สมอง" ของโปรเจกต์ จัดการการสุ่มตัวอย่างความร้อนแบบหลายทิศทาง และประสานงานกับ heaters และ stepper sync
- 1.75mm PLA Filament: มอบ "Structural Link" ที่ชัดเจนและเชื่อถือได้สำหรับทุกจุดของการทดสอบ calibration
- SD Card: มอบ physical interface ที่มีความจุสูงและเชื่อถือได้สำหรับทุก "Calibration Mission" ที่สำเร็จ
- Slic3r / Cura: จำเป็นสำหรับการป้องกันที่ชัดเจนและประหยัดพลังงานสำหรับทุกจุดของการสร้าง G-code
- Hot-End / Thermistor: จำเป็นสำหรับการให้ digital signal path ที่ชัดเจนและประหยัดพลังงานสำหรับทุกจุดของการตรวจสอบความร้อนจากการตรวจจับข้อมูลของคุณ
- USB Cable: ใช้สำหรับโปรแกรม Arduino ของคุณ และเป็น interface หลักสำหรับ system controller
Calibration Hub Automation and Interaction Step-by-Step
กระบวนการปรับแต่งที่ขับเคลื่อนด้วยการตรวจจับระยะใกล้ถูกออกแบบมาให้มีประสิทธิภาพสูง:
- Initialize Workspace: ใส่ filament และ Materia 101 ของคุณเข้าที่ในเวิร์คช็อปอย่างถูกต้อง และเชื่อมต่อเข้ากับ PC USB port
- Setup High-Speed Sync: ใน Slic3r console ให้เริ่มต้น
Temp-Tower-profileและกำหนดช่วง layer ในsetup() - Internal Dialogue Loop: สถานีจะทำการตรวจสอบความร้อนแบบวนรอบประสิทธิภาพสูงอย่างต่อเนื่อง และอัปเดตสถานะการพิมพ์แบบเรียลไทม์ตามตำแหน่งและการตั้งค่าของคุณ
- Visual and Data Feedback Integration: สังเกตเครื่องพิมพ์ 3D ของคุณที่จะกลายเป็น rhythmic status signal โดยอัตโนมัติ โดยจะกะพริบและติดตามการตั้งค่าตำแหน่งของคุณจากระยะไกล
Future Expansion
- OLED Identity Dashboard Integration: เพิ่มจอแสดงผล OLED ขนาดเล็กเพื่อแสดง "Final Optimum Temp" หรือ "Battery (%)"
- Multi-sensor Climate Sync Synchronization: เชื่อมต่อ "Bluetooth Tracker" เฉพาะทางเพื่อทำการ "Local Paging" ที่มีความแม่นยำสูงขึ้นแบบไร้สายผ่าน cloud
- Cloud Interface Registration Support Synchronization: เพิ่ม web-dashboard เฉพาะทางบน smartphone ผ่าน WiFi/BT เพื่อติดตามและบันทึกประวัติทั้งหมดอย่างแม่นยำ
- Advanced Velocity Profile Customization Support: เพิ่มโค้ด "Machine Learning (vCore)" เฉพาะทางเพื่อให้สามารถเปลี่ยน triggers ได้โดยอัตโนมัติโดยอิงจากความสูงของผู้ใช้!
Perfect Temp for Filament เป็นโปรเจกต์ที่สมบูรณ์แบบสำหรับผู้ที่ชื่นชอบวิทยาศาสตร์ที่กำลังมองหาเครื่องมือเชิงกลที่โต้ตอบและน่าสนใจยิ่งขึ้น!
promotional video available for reference!
[!IMPORTANT] PLA Filament ต้องใช้ Extrusion temperature mapping ที่แม่นยำ (เช่น 180-220 องศา) ในการตั้งค่าเพื่อหลีกเลี่ยงการอุดตันหรือการยึดเกาะที่ไม่ดี โปรดตรวจสอบให้แน่ใจเสมอว่าคุณมี Fail-Safe flag ที่เหมาะสมใน loop หากเครื่องพิมพ์หยุดทำงาน!